Tractor Battery vs. Car Battery: How Are They Different?

April 25, 2022 by Hardik K

Tractor Battery vs Car Battery

Are you someone who believes that a tractor battery and car battery are the same?

Although both of these batteries are the batteries used to start a vehicle, still, there are some fundamental differences between the two. A farm tractor battery may be used in a car; however, a car battery cannot be used for a farm tractor.

Let’s dive deeper to learn the actual difference between a farm tractor battery and a car battery.

Durability and Service Life

  • The key factor that differentiates a farm tractor battery from a car battery is its durability and service life.
  • Every battery has a different Cold Cranking Ampere (CCA). It is the ability of a battery to start (crank) an engine in a cold environment at low temperatures.
  • Since a tractor is driven in harsh climatic conditions and rugged terrains, it needs higher cold cranking amps to start the engine.
  • Not just CCA, but a farm tractor battery needs a deep-cycle service, which delivers more amp-hours (AH).
  • AH is the measure of power that a battery can provide over a given length of time.

Difference In The Design

  • A car battery is designed to produce a large amount of current in a short time period.
  • On the other hand, a farm tractor battery, which is a deep-cycle battery, generates a steady amount of current over a long time period.
  • A tractor battery is capable of withstanding a higher number of discharge cycles compared to a car battery.

Why Does a Farm Tractor Battery Have Higher Durability Than a Car Battery?

  • An alternator is a direct source of electric current for the vehicle. Along with the battery, it works to generate power for the different electric components in a vehicle.
  • An alternator transforms mechanical energy into electrical energy as an alternate current.
  • Proper functioning of the alternator helps to recharge a vehicle’s battery.
  • In a tractor, the alternator is unable to recharge the farm tractor battery sufficiently to keep pace with the requirement.
  • For this reason, a farm tractor battery has a higher cranking power and reserve capacity.
  • The reverse capacity of a battery is the number of minutes that a fully charged battery can sustain at 25 amps current before the voltage starts decreasing.

A car battery generates a higher cranking power at the start. However, a deep-cycle battery such as a tractor battery is more durable. Both car batteries and tractor batteries are lead-acid batteries, having a voltage of 12V.

It is important to choose the right battery for the right application. It is essential to use a farm tractor battery in a tractor and not think about installing a car battery in it and vice versa. Choosing the right battery is crucial for the performance and life of your vehicle.
